Enjoying whiskey engages all your senses, but taste is undoubtedly the most difficult to define. Sight, smell and memory all feed into our taste. On this episode of Around the Barrel, host Lucas Hendrickson joins veteran whiskey journalist Fred Minnick to learn more about the time and practice needed to develop a whiskey vocabulary to articulate this concept of taste, how a person’s palate can be as unique as a fingerprint and how his years as a whiskey expert have spawned a slew of magazine, book and video creations that explore whiskey from different angles.
